TUCSON, Ariz. --- The Western Oregon softball team dropped a pair of games and moved to 2-2 at the Cactus Classic on Saturday.
The Wolves opened up with a 6-0 loss to Mercyhurst before dropping a 5-1 decision to Georgian Court.
In the loss to Georgian Court, WOU (7-9) took a 1-0 lead when
Kirah McGlothan drew a bases loaded walk to make it 1-0 before Georgian Court tied it in the bottom of the first. The score remained that way until GC scored a run in the fourth, two in the fifth and another in the sixth.
The Wolves managed three hits in the contest, one each from
Chelby Smalley,
Sydney Conklin and
Victoria Zimmerman.
Maddie Mayer picked up the loss, going five innings and giving up four runs on six hits with two strikeouts and four walks.
WOU concludes play at the event 9 a.m. Sunday against UM Crookston.
